A number used once. The AP's in message 1, the station's in message 2.
Thirty-two octets, more than a quarter of the whole descriptor, and the reason two sessions with the same passphrase get different keys. Both nonces go into the key derivation along with both MAC addresses; anyone who captures both can derive the session key IF they also know the passphrase, which is exactly why capturing a handshake is the first step in cracking one.
